Q: What is the difference between a Cinematic Video and a 3D Virtual Tour?

A: That's a great question!

- A 3D Virtual Tour (like Matterport) is an interactive, self-guided experience. It allows potential buyers to digitally "walk through" the home at their own pace, exploring every room from a 360-degree perspective. It's like a 24/7 virtual open house.

- A Cinematic Video is a non-interactive, guided "highlight reel" of the property. We use creative camera movements, music, and editing to create an emotional connection and showcase the home's best features in a compelling, movie-like format.

Q: Can you Photoshop items out of photos, like removing a car from the driveway or fixing a crack in the wall?

A: Our editing process includes color correction, sharpening, and enhancements. We generally do not digitally alter the physical condition or permanent features of the property. Minor object removals or complex retouching (like lawn repair or advanced sky replacements) may be possible for an additional revision fee; please inquire for a quote. We recommend the property is fully prepared beforehand.

Q: What are the usage rights for the photos?

A: You (the client who paid for the service) are granted a license to use the images and videos for the purpose of marketing the specific property for sale or lease. The copyright and ownership of the media remain with Peaceful films. The license is non-transferable and expires once the property has sold or the listing is terminated.
